Transaction 8939e167948aabfaec5e26c557a9ec8696b0f3149e818eb87fe015696cd12773

1 Input
2 Outputs
  • 8939e167948aabfaec5e26c557a9ec8696b0f3149e818eb87fe015696cd12773:0
  • value  20000000
    address  1LR6AXpRhXZ6gXGkErGA61gyaTbgg9EBZy
  • 8939e167948aabfaec5e26c557a9ec8696b0f3149e818eb87fe015696cd12773:1
  • value  23461400
    address  3HYu7Ebr6PuNd43mNNCNP6fM5rMJzDveQt